E63
CLS 55
CLS63
SL55
SLK55
1. Limited Slip Locking Diff
2. 2 Piece Wheels
3. Alcantra/Leather Steering Wheel
4. Increased Speed Limiter
5. Nurburgring Tuned Suspension ( control arms/stabalizers & slightly lower stance)
6. Bigger Brakes
7. Higher Speed Rated Tires

Difference in rear gear ratio is between different models (E55 is 2.65, E63 & Sl55 are 2.82, Sl63 is 3.06, etc.)
